CLEVELAND — A majority of Ohioans favored at least some action on student loan forgiveness and climate change, according to new polling results.
The poll, conducted by SurveyUSA for Baldwin Wallace University, asked 856 registered Ohio voters their opinions of a variety of topics, including gun control, student loan debt forgiveness, favorability of Gov. Mike DeWine/President Joe Biden and more. The online poll was conducted from Sept. 30 through Oct. 3 and included a randomly selected group of adults.
